What will you be doing?
The selected candidate will be a part of our Business Intelligence (BI) team for the In Store Audits group. The candidate will be responsible for delivering ad hoc and custom BI reports for different Circana clients based on specific In store conditions.
Job Responsibilities
- Building custom ad hoc BI reports based on the business need of the different client
- Use SQL , Custom visualizers to build and visualize the report
- Compute different Sales and Shelf measure based on the type of analysis
Experience : 5 years
Technical Skills
- Hands on with SQL coding and scripting. This is a must have skill (primary skills)
- Hands on experience in writing and optimizing SQL queries in SSMS.
- Skilled in writing SQL stored procedure coding and custom functions for either derived tables or reports.
- Proficient in using Tableau / Power BI to create tabular report and visualizations. (Secondary skills)
- Experience in Data analysis (familiar with Imputation, outlier detection, etc.)
- Experience in working with large volumes of data
- Good quantitative skills
- Experience in SSRS to create tabular / drill down reports is not mandatory but good to have.
- Experience in Python , R would be good to have.
